All-terrain pushchairs
All-terrain pushchairs are great for parents who love to go for walks in the countryside and hikes or even run. These pushchairs come with a lockable swivel front wheel, air-filled tires and an excellent suspension that makes them suitable for uneven terrain as well as bumpy terrain. They're also suitable for babies and come with a warm and ventilated newborn cocoon so that your baby can enjoy the outdoors from birth.
Based on what you require depending on your needs, there are different kinds of all-terrain strollers. Some are specially designed and are specifically designed for off-road use, while others are more adaptable and can be used for walking and running in the city and countryside. Some have the option to connect a car seat, carrycot, or even a stroller.
Verify that the buggy has been officially approved for use. This will affect how easy it is to maneuver and how much weight it can hold. You might want to consider one with an inflated front tire since it will be easier to control, particularly on rough terrain.
The seat is another feature to consider. Are they rear-facing or forward-facing? And can it recline in a flat position. Also, make sure that the seat has an observation panel inside the hood to keep an eye on your little one. Similarly, a brake control that swivels on the handlebar is useful for adjusting the speed and direction.
Storage is another aspect to consider. Find out if the pushchair includes a large basket that can be extended and an open-air pocket on the swivel-backrest to store your phones and keys. Some all-terrain strollers come with cups holders that are handy and reflective elements.
It's important to note that pushchairs with three wheel pushchair wheels are typically larger than those with four wheels, which means they may have trouble fitting through doors that are standard or steps. Also, you'll need plenty of space in your car's boot or hallway for storing them when they aren't being used. Many models are compact and fold easily and fit into smaller vehicles. And if you do need to store them there are some with clever click-off wheels that let the front wheels to be removed without any fuss, leaving just the main chassis in place.

Easy to fold
If you plan to travel with a baby, you need a pushchair that is easy to fold and fold. This will save you time and energy, particularly in the event that you use public transportation frequently. Be sure you test this feature before purchasing, and then check the time required to fold and unfold the buggy. Also, take into consideration whether or not the model includes additional features like an additional seat or a parent-facing unit. You might find these options more expensive, so check out their prices before deciding.
If you're looking to purchase a three-wheeler pushchair, make sure you select a model that has an enduring fabric that is able to endure the elements. This will reduce the frequency you need to clean the pushchair, and it's also a good idea to look for models with air-filled tyres that are puncture-proof or have an easy-release mechanism.
